""Beacon Hill: Its Ancient Pastures And Early Mansions"" is a historical book written by Allen Chamberlain that explores the rich history of Boston's Beacon Hill neighborhood. The book takes readers on a journey through the area's past, from its days as a grazing ground for cows to its transformation into one of the city's most affluent neighborhoods. Chamberlain delves into the architecture of the early mansions that once stood on Beacon Hill, including the homes of prominent figures such as John Hancock and Henry Cabot Lodge. He also provides insight into the social and cultural life of the neighborhood, from the early days of the Boston Brahmins to the present day.
